Just got back from our vacation and Discovery Cove was the highlight!!
We checked in, got our wetsuits because it was only about 50 when we got there. The wet suits keep you very warm and they come in sizes to fit everyone.
We snorkled for the longest time. We were unable to dive down at all. So don't worry about not staying afloat, you'll have no problems.
Got our pictures with the stingrays. They're not feeding them now because of the baby rays, but it's still a lot of fun. We then went to the bird room (go in early morning for lots of excitement!)
Time for the dolphin swim. We got Dixie! Had a wonderful time with her. The photos weren't the greatest, but that was our only dissapointment.
On our way out, we mentioned it to a staff member and she said that on slow days (there were only about 450 people there our day) you can pay and extra $55 - and swim again with the dolphins!
It's called double dipping........
This time we got Rose! Again a wonderful time and the pictures came out great!!!! I also did the birthday package and it was worth it. My dd got extra interaction/video/picture time. Tyler (the dolphin from the pod next to us) brought my dd her birthday buoy! Very cute! She also got a delicious four layer cake, camera and t-shirt.

Sounds great was that $55 each for a reswim on slow days:jester:
 
yeah the $55- was for each person, but it was worth it. We really enjoyed getting in the pool again with the dolphins. They all have such different personalities so it was great. I figured it would be a while before we got back to DC so it was worth the extra $$ for another fun ride!!!! It seemed like the afternoon time was longer, but I'm not sure. In the a.m. we got Dixie. In the afternoon, we had Rose and then Tyler came by with my dd's birthday buoy and CJ came over for a while too.

with the weather only being 50 degrees, were you guys real cold or was it okay? We are going in January
 
It warmed up to about 65, but we were fine. Get there early for the best choice of wetsuits. We checked in about 7:45am. Many of the swim areas are very warm. The wet suits keep you very warm!!!!!!
Have fun and if it's slow that day, ask for a double dip and swim again with the dolphins!!!!!!
